private void AddAttachments(RenewalLetter template) { var attachmentFragments = new List <DocumentFragment>(); //if (chkWarning.Checked) if (template.IsWarningSel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.GeneralAdviceWarning]); } //if (chkRisks.Checked) if (template.IsRisksSel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.UninsuredRisksReviewList]); } //if (chkPrivacy.Checked) if (template.IsPrivacySel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.PrivacyStatement]); } //if (chkSatutory.Checked) if (template.IsSatutorySel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.StatutoryNotices]); } //if (chkFSG.Checked) if (template.IsFSGSel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.FinancialServicesGuide]); } _presenter.InsertSubFragments(Constants.WordBookmarks.RenewalLetterSub, Constants.WordBookmarks.RenewalLetterMain, attachmentFragments); }
private void AddAttachments(RenewalLetter template) { var attachmentFragments = new List <DocumentFragment>(); if (template.IsSatutorySel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.StatutoryNotices]); } if (template.IsPrivacySel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.PrivacyStatement]); } if (template.IsFSGSel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.FinancialServicesGuide]); } if (template.IsAdviceWarningSel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.GeneralAdviceWarning]); } if (template.IsRisksSelected) { attachmentFragments.Add(_availableAttachments[Constants.FragmentKeys.UninsuredRisksReviewList]); } _presenter.InsertSubFragments(Constants.WordBookmarks.RenewalLetterSub, Constants.WordBookmarks.RenewalLetterMain, attachmentFragments, Settings.Default.BlankFragmentBase); }